Runbook: recovering access to tailpipe

If someone on support gets locked out of tailpipe (our CLI for tailing prod logs), don't re-image their laptop — it's almost always an expired session token. Run `tailpipe auth reset`, have them re-enroll, and confirm they can stream the heartbeat topic. If reset fails because the local keystore is corrupted, you'll need to rebuild it from the team recovery bundle. The bundle decrypts with the passphrase below.

vault phrase of bagaf-kajeg = jorath-feniel-briir-siliel-ralix

**Checklist item 7 — Queue-depth autoscaler**

Quick sanity pass on the Fanwick autoscaler: confirm the scale-up threshold still reads from config, not the hardcoded value we yanked last sprint, and that scale-down respects the 5-minute cooldown. Also eyeball the backlog metric name — it got renamed once already. Any questions on intent should go straight to the component owner below.

named custodian: Brivan Eliath Quenox Frador

**Ticket QRX-482: Health check drift behind the Larkspur LB**

Hey plugin folks — we've noticed the health check settings behind the Larkspur load balancer have drifted between nodes again. Two nodes still probe the old `/status` path, so the LB keeps flapping plugins in and out of rotation. Until the sync job is fixed, please pin your test harnesses to the canonical settings. The expected values are listed below.

settings of bafof-bagef:
[pelix]
port = 5432
region = outer-1
host = pelix.crelvoio.corp
team = julax
timeout_ms = 3000
retries = 8

**Ticket #4471 — Signature check failing on cron sync**

Heads up, new folks: the Wrenfield cron drift job started failing its signature check last night. Turns out the drift investigator was still verifying manifests against the key we retired during the Opaline cleanup. Nodes that hadn't synced kept passing, which is how the drift hid for a week. Fix: update your local verifier to the current key, pasted below.

signing key of bagap-yawep = bky13_TbfT6ZMUoGJo2